Output 61abba53ebc3864f0562bbb5c6949bbe457f6f9cc5dcdf4568bae22374cd9e7f:3

value
75760827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f32bb70cbe4d22b5d42b78570c0a92b878f1de9 OP_EQUAL
address
MDfKaT3Zax247yyi4qQq1QHRj1iFjASNK7
transaction
61abba53ebc3864f0562bbb5c6949bbe457f6f9cc5dcdf4568bae22374cd9e7f
spent
true